Subject: SQL lint rules for partner submissions

Hi team — starting next sprint, all SQL files submitted through the Cobblewick integration pipeline will be checked by our sqlward linter: lowercase keywords are rejected, and every statement needs an explicit schema prefix. Failures return a report via the lint API so support can relay results to partners. When calling the lint API on a partner's behalf, authenticate with the bearer token below.

session JWT of yawep-yawep = eyJhbGciOiJIUzI1NiIsInR5cCI6IkpXVCJ9.eyJzdWIiOiI3pWF3_In0.aXYsHiog

**FAQ: What if the ChronoGate chip reader loses its config after a firmware flash?**

This comes up most race seasons, so noting it ahead of the weekly sync. When a ChronoGate mat reader is reflashed, its encrypted settings bundle stays on the device but the unlock key is wiped. The reader will boot into recovery mode and prompt at the serial console. Restore is quick: at the prompt, type the recovery passphrase that appears directly below.

recovery phrase for fawif-tajeg: norael-aldmir-casir-brivan-ulaion

Subject: Contrast audit results for Lumora 4.2

Team, the color-contrast audit on the Lumora dashboard wrapped up yesterday. Most components pass, but the muted badge text and the secondary nav links fall below the required ratio in dark mode. Fixes landed on the release branch this morning and should ship with the next cut. The audited build token is listed below.

trace token, fafof-tajef: htk9_849b0fd88

Welcome to the FoldHub crew!

Quick tour of the laundry-locker access flow before your first release: when a customer scans their pickup code at a FoldHub kiosk, the gateway checks the reservation table, pops the locker latch, and logs the event. You'll mostly care about the release gate — don't ship if the latch-event queue is backed up, since stale reservations cause double-assignments. Everything runs against the lockers schema on the primary cluster, and you can connect with the string below:

replica DSN, kajep-yahag: mssql://praok_svc:iF@db-8d68.plorvaio.local:5432/eliion